Earnings for Sociology Graduates from Bridgewater State University

Students who complete Bridgewater State University’s Sociology program earn the following amounts (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):

Median earnings by years after graduation for Sociology at Bridgewater State University
Years After Graduation Median Earnings
1 year $34,668
2 years $33,637
3 years $32,302
4 years $38,737
5 years $48,932

How does this compare to the school overall? Four years after graduating, Sociology graduates from Bridgewater State University report median earnings of $38,737, compared with $53,189 for all Bridgewater State University graduates — about 27% lower than the school-wide median.

Student Demographics & Diversity

The following sections describe the student demographics for Sociology graduates at Bridgewater State University, by degree type.

Across all degree levels, Sociology graduates at Bridgewater State University are 89% women (42) and 11% men (5).

Sociology Bachelor’s Program at Bridgewater State University

Of the 47 bachelor’s sociology degrees awarded at Bridgewater State University, 89% were women (42) and 11% were men (5).

Bridgewater State University gender breakdown of Sociology Bachelor's degree recipients

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Sociology bachelor’s degree recipients at Bridgewater State University.

Race / Ethnicity Number of Graduates
White 34
Hispanic / Latino 6
Black / African American 4
Asian 1
Two or More Races 2
Racial-ethnic diversity of Sociology majors at Bridgewater State University

Minority students account for 28% of Sociology bachelor’s degree recipients at Bridgewater State University, below the national average of 56%.*

*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
